Played linebacker in the National Football League, primarily with the Seattle Seahawks. After retiring from professional football, took on roles as an assistant coach and later became a pastor. Engaged in community services and youth mentorship. Passed away in 2013.

A mathematician and philosopher, contributions included foundational work in various areas of mathematics and logic. Promoted the importance of mathematical rigor and continuity. His work on the Bolzano-Weierstrass theorem became a critical component of real analysis. Engaged in critical examination of philosophical ideas regarding mathematics, introducing concepts relevant to the philosophy of mathematics.
